Training your brain is essential for maintaining cognitive function, improving memory, and enhancing problem-solving skills. Just like physical exercise strengthens muscles, mental exercises and engaging activities help keep the brain sharp and agile. With the increasing demands of modern life, it is crucial to develop habits that enhance brain function and overall mental health. By incorporating specific techniques and activities into daily routines, individuals can boost their cognitive abilities and maintain mental clarity throughout their lives.
One of the most effective ways to train the brain is through continuous learning and mental challenges. Engaging in activities such as reading, solving puzzles, playing chess, or learning a new language stimulates the brain and strengthens neural connections. Studies have shown that challenging the mind with new information and complex tasks can enhance memory retention and cognitive flexibility. Additionally, engaging in brain-training apps or logic games can provide a fun and structured way to improve problem-solving skills and mental agility. By consistently pushing the brain to learn and adapt, individuals can significantly enhance their cognitive abilities and mental resilience.
Another powerful method for brain training involves physical exercise and a healthy diet. Regular physical activity, such as aerobic exercise, yoga, or strength training, promotes better blood circulation and oxygen flow to the brain, improving overall cognitive function. Exercise has also been linked to the production of neurotransmitters that support memory and learning. Additionally, consuming a brain-healthy diet rich in omega-3 fatty acids, antioxidants, and essential nutrients can enhance brain function and protect against cognitive decline. Foods such as nuts, berries, fish, and leafy greens provide vital nutrients that support mental clarity and brain health. By maintaining a balanced diet and engaging in regular physical activity, individuals can optimize their cognitive performance and long-term brain health.
Lastly, mindfulness, meditation, and adequate sleep play a crucial role in brain training and mental well-being. Practicing mindfulness and meditation has been proven to reduce stress, improve focus, and enhance emotional regulation. These practices allow individuals to develop better concentration and a greater sense of self-awareness, which can lead to improved decision-making skills. Additionally, ensuring adequate sleep is essential for brain function, as it allows the brain to consolidate memories, process information, and eliminate toxins that accumulate throughout the day. By prioritizing rest, relaxation, and mindfulness techniques, individuals can support their cognitive health and overall mental well-being.
